The Dilemma
Diego and Jae are in their school's computer lab working on a group project. Diego has just received a brand-new, top-of-the-line gaming laptop from his parents as a reward for his good grades. Jae, who is using an older, slower computer, compliments Diego on his new laptop. As they work, Diego notices Jae struggling with the slow speed of his computer, which is affecting their project progress. Diego feels proud of his new possession but also values the quality of their work and Jae's friendship. He considers offering Jae his laptop to use for the project, knowing it would speed things up and show his generosity. However, he also enjoys the admiration and status his new laptop brings him. Diego now faces a choice: (A) offer Jae his laptop for the project, because generosity and teamwork matter more than a possession, or (B) keep his laptop and suggest Jae use the school computers, because it is a gift from his parents and he is responsible for taking care of it.
